Study Summary
High order aberrations (HOA) are visual phenomena that decrease quality of vision. Examples of high order aberration are glare, halos, decreased contrast sensitivity and shape distortion. They are caused by slight imperfections or distortions in the corneal surface. HOA are currently measured using a variety of FDA approved devices. For this study, the LADARWave (Alcon) will be used to measure HOA. This device uses a harmless beam of light. It is FDA approved and non-invasive. Contact lens induced high order aberrations have never been measured and reported in the literature. This work may provide information to guide future contact lens design.
